I used Bambu Lab P2S for this print. The filament was Bambu Lab PETG Basic. Bambu Studio was the slicer.

Lesson learned the hard way: never ignore filament shrinkage! My initial parts had awful tolerances, but thankfully, I discovered the fine-tuning and shrinkage compensation settings in Bambu Studio to fix the geometry.

BUT... I still have a major unresolved issue. The weight distribution on the moving parts is completely uneven, and I honestly can't figure out why. 🤷‍♂️

Is it an infill issue? Slicer settings? Something else? How do you guys balance your 3D-printed mechanical parts? I need your help on this one! Thanks.
